tough choice
i love the interior and exterior of the si, but i'm starting to consider the gti. the lack of torque in the si has me worried, and 197hp isn't exactly something to brag about. then theres the ms3 which looks even worse than the gti, but is faster.

my dad drives an 06 GTI (i have an 07 SI sedan), and while i am impressed by it, i did chose an si over it. The GTI has a sweet power band, and because of that feels faster in everyday driving. the overall handeling feel of the car is very sporty, but just not quite like the feel of the SI. the same thing goes for the shifter. I always thought the GTIs shifts were very smooth and quick untill i got my SI, which is at a diffrent level. And last of all the look. the when i think of the GTI's design, the best adjective i can think of is turdy, especially compared to the the sleak lines of the SI.
all this being said, i think if you are older and want a more conservative but sporty car(my dad exactly), the GTI is probably your better choice, but if your a teenager like me who appreciates good natured aggresive driving and wants a car that will turn a few more heads, by all means get the SI |
